Instead of chasing the bargain-basement deals of the most beaten-up stocks, focus on high-quality shares that can weather the storm. “Investors should avoid volatile names and be cautious on both deep-value and unprofitable growth companies,” advises Koesterich. “Instead, emphasize quality with a focus on earnings consistency and good profitability.”
But what exactly does high-quality mean? It means looking for companies with solid fundamentals, like strong earnings and revenue growth. It means considering free cash flow and value ratios like forward price-to-earnings (P/E) ratios. And it means seeking out companies that have generous and growing dividends, as these are hallmarks of high-quality investments. Caroline Randall, portfolio manager at Capital Group, believes that dividends will play a bigger role in total returns moving forward.
